The Triple Lion Dance is extraordinary not only because it stars the legendary actor Kanzaburo, but also his sons Kankuro and Shichinosuke who shine as the younger lions, showcasing three of Japan\u2019s most revered mythical beasts. The father lion is one of the most sought-after roles for Kabuki actors.<\/p>\n<p><em>RAKUDA<\/em> (The Camel)<br \/>\nWhen unpopular tenant Uma dies, his only friend Hanji schemes to make some money. He sends Kyuroku, the junk collector, to demand support for the funeral ceremony from Uma\u2019s miserly landlord \u2013 or the dead Uma will come to his house and dance.
